The path was the approximately 6 steps (later expanded to 12 steps) used by those first 42 sober alcoholics. Sobriety was the successful result of taking these steps. To fail in 1937 meant they returned to drinking. Chapter five of the AA Big Book, “How It Works,” begins with a bold statement: “Rarely have we seen a person fail who has thoroughly followed our path.”. The following two and a half pages are typically read at the beginning of every AA meeting and contain the essence of the program of Alcoholics Anonymous.“Rarely have we seen a person fail who has thoroughly followed our path.” – Alcoholics Anonymous, pg. 58
